Scanner类有一个静态字段public static final InputSteam in
hasNextXxx 可以接受很多种数据类型
nextInt
nextLine
创建两个Scanner 对象
统一都用String 类型去接受,你需要什么类型,在转换什么类型
String类
final,用String类创造出来的字符串都是常量.一旦初始化就不能被改不能被改变,值不能被改变,长度
String ss = "abc"
ss ="def"
构造方法
空构造String s1 = new String();
字节数组转换成字符串
字节数组中的一部分转换成字符串
字符数组转换成字符串
字符数组中的一部分转换成字符串
字符串转换为字符串 //有范围的方法基本包含头不包含尾
判断功能
区分大小写判断是否同一个字符序列 equals()
不区分大小写 equalsIgnoreCase()
包含 contains
以什么开头 startsWith
以什么结尾 endsWith
判断是否为空 isEmpty
获取功能
长度length()
根据索引获得指定位置的字符 indexof()
截取字符串.返回一个新的字符串subString
准换功能
字符串转换为字符数组toCharArray()
将字符串变成大写toUperCase()
将字符串变成小写toLowerCase()
字符串连接comcat()
其他功能
替换replace()
去掉两端的空格trim()
按照字典的顺序去比较 区分大小写 compareTo()
按照字段的顺序去比较 不区分大小写 compareToIgnoreCase()
|
|